背景情况:
- 足球赛季后的过渡期往往会损害球员的健康状况.
- 实施有针对性的培训可以减轻这些负面影响,并可能提高绩效.
研究的目的:
- 评估过渡期高频运动计划对足球运动员身体健康关键指标的影响.
- 评估有氧能力的变化,下肢的异动力学强度,跳跃性能和身体组成.
主要方法:
- 实施了为期6周的过渡期计划,包括2周的完全休息,然后是4周的培训.
- 训练包括每周3次有氧和2次最大力量训练.
- 13名年轻足球运动员参与了这项研究,并在干预前后评估了他们的体能参数.
主要成果:
- 干预后最大氧气摄入量 (VO2max) 显著改善 (p=0.037).
- 右四头肌的反运动跳跃性能和同动力扭矩显著下降 (分别为p=0.009和p=0.004).
- 其他测量参数没有显著变化 (p>0.05).
结论:
- 在足球过渡期间,一个结构化的高频训练计划可以抵消典型的训练效应.
- 在此期间,特定的训练刺激甚至可能导致某些健身组件的改善.
- 谨慎的计划设计对于在休赛期间优化健身维护和发展至关重要.

Exercise significantly impacts cardiovascular response, which is crucial for understanding patient health and designing effective treatment plans.
Light to moderate physical activity initiates a series of interconnected responses in the body. The heart rate modestly increases in anticipation of the workout, followed by widespread vasodilation as oxygen consumption by skeletal muscles increases. Exercise induces a range of adaptations in muscle tissue, depending on the type and duration of activity. Such physical training can be broadly categorized into two types: endurance exercises and resistance exercises.

Regular physical activity is essential for maintaining cardiovascular health, with aerobic exercises being particularly effective. According to the American Heart Association, 150 minutes of moderate to intense aerobic exercise per week is recommended for a healthy heart. Aerobic activities may include brisk walking, running, bicycling, cross-country skiing, and swimming, ideally performed three to five times per week.
